Job Description
Acupuncturist (Advanced Level)
Qualifications
Applicants pending the completion of educational or certification/licensure requirements may be referred and tentatively selected but may not be hired until all requirements are met.
Basic Requirements:
Citizenship
Citizen of the United States
After a determination is made that it is not possible to recruit qualified citizens, necessary personnel may be appointed on a temporary basis under authority of 38 U.S.C. 7405 without regard to the citizenship requirements of 38 U.S.C. 7402 or any other law prohibiting the employment of or payment of compensation to a person who is not a citizen of the United States
Education
Individual must meet one of the requirements below:(1) Master's degree in acupuncture or oriental medicine from a program accredited by the Accreditation Commission for Acupuncture and Oriental Medicine (ACAOM)
OR (2) Advanced level degree in acupuncture or oriental medicine from a program accredited by the Accreditation Commission for Acupuncture and Oriental Medicine (ACAOM)
Certification
Acupuncturists hired in the VHA must be board certified through the National Certification Commission for Acupuncture and Oriental Medicine (NCCAOM)
The board certification must be current and the acupuncturist must abide by the certifying body's requirements for continuing education
Licensure
Current, full, active, and unrestricted license to practice acupuncture in a State, Territory or Commonwealth (i.e
Puerto Rico) of the United States, or District of Columbia
English Language Proficiency
Candidates will not be appointed under authority of 38 U.S.C. chapters 73 or 74, to serve in a direct patient-care capacity in VHA who are not proficient in written and spoken English
Creditable Experience Knowledge of Acupuncture Practices
To be creditable, the experience must demonstrate possession of Knowledge, Skills, and Abilities (KSA) associated with current professional acupuncture practice
The experience must be post-master's degree or above
Quality of Experience
Experience is only creditable if it is obtained following graduation with a certificate, masters or doctoral degree in Acupuncture or Oriental Medicine from an accredited training program
Creditable experience must include work as a professional licensed acupuncturist
Qualifying experience must also be at a level comparable to acupuncture experience at the next lower grade level
For all assignments above the full performance level, the higher level duties must consist of significantly larger scope, administrative independence, difficulty and range of variety and described in this standard at the specified grade level and be performed by the incumbent at least 25% of the time
In addition to the basic requirements, completion of a minimum of one year of performing progressively complex experience equivalent to the GS-11 grade level and meet the KSAs at the GS-11 level
Ability to screen referrals and direct veterans to other services as appropriate
Ability to formulate an appropriate differential diagnosis
Ability to formulate an acupuncture treatment plan independently or with other health care professionals
Ability to educate patients on health lifestyle changes including nutrition, exercise, sleeping habits, stress management, mind body techniques and other matters related to acupuncture care
This includes the ability to communicate with individuals of varying backgrounds
Skill in the selection and use of the appropriate acupuncture tools and supplies based on needs of the patient
AND, Demonstrated Knowledge, Skills, and Abilities (KSA)
In addition to the experience above, the candidate must demonstrate all of the following KSAs: Skill and ability to perform safe and effective advanced acupuncture techniques
Knowledge of complex issues surrounding the delivery of care as it relates to acupuncture services, such as evidence based and cost effectiveness
Ability to apply and adapt acupuncture to new and changing programs
Knowledge of research strategies, methodologies and principles
Ability to problem solve issues surrounding delivery of acupuncture
